This double-fronted detached home on Lawrence Avenue offers substantial, flexible family living across three floors. Recently extended and renovated, the house provides bright, well-proportioned accommodation totalling 2,578 sq ft, including a principal bedroom with en-suite, up to six bedrooms, three bathrooms and a large open-plan kitchen/living/diner – ideal for everyday family life and entertaining.
Practical family features include a south‑westerly rear garden with terrace and astro turf, a large playroom/den with high ceilings, an air‑conditioned home gym with storage, utility and study rooms, plus off‑street parking for two cars. The property sits close to Mill Hill Park, good schools and local shops, making everyday routines and leisure easy to manage.
Notable negatives are factual and important for buyers: broadband speeds in the area are reported as slow, the property dates from the 1930s–1940s and external walls are solid brick (no known cavity insulation), so buyers may wish to budget for future insulation works. Council Tax is Band F and will be relatively expensive. Overall, the house is a spacious, recently refurbished family home with strong local amenities, but some running costs and retrofit considerations to factor in.
